Open Access for All: Cultivating Inclusive Community Initiatives

Building truly welcoming communities requires a commitment to accessibility in all aspects of community life. This means ensuring that everyone, regardless of their disabilities, has the opportunity to fully participate and contribute. Community programs should be designed with this principle in mind, offering diverse opportunities for engagement that address the needs of all members. By removing obstacles and creating truly open doors, we can foster a sense of belonging and empower everyone to thrive within our communities.

  • As an illustration, community centers could offer programs in accessible formats, including sign language interpretation or large-print materials.
  • Additionally, public spaces should be designed with universal principles in mind, ensuring that people of all abilities can navigate them easily.

These are just a few examples of how communities can work towards greater inclusivity. By embracing the principles of accessibility and making a conscious effort to embrace everyone, we can create truly enriching and vibrant communities for all.
